* [https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Diablo_II:_Resurrected Diablo II: Resurrected] was released on Windows (Battle.net), Nintendo Switch, PlayStation, and Xbox One on September 23, 2021, and on Steam on February 12, 2026[https://news.blizzard.com/en-us/article/24243863/rain-annihilation-in-reign-of-the-warlock#Reign].&lt;br /&gt;
* Is a separate game, not an expansion to [[Diablo II]]. It must be purchased separately from the legacy version &amp;#039;&amp;#039;and&amp;#039;&amp;#039; separately on each platform.&lt;br /&gt;
* Players can create [[Classic]] and [[Expansion]] characters.&lt;br /&gt;
* Unless stated otherwise, all content of this wiki is valid for the current patch of the Expansion. Some differences between the Expansion and Resurrected are outlined below.&lt;br /&gt;
* Besides improved graphics, D2R introduced some Quality of Life improvements, some of which can be toggled off, and plenty of bugfixes. Subsequent patches added some new content.&lt;br /&gt;
* Ladders have not been part of the original release of the game and were added later.&lt;br /&gt;

==Game modes==&lt;br /&gt;
===Offline===&lt;br /&gt;
* This is the &amp;quot;single player&amp;quot; experience.&lt;br /&gt;
* Character and shared stash saves are stored client-side.&lt;br /&gt;
* One can use cheating tools to modify the saves or install game mods.&lt;br /&gt;
* The &amp;quot;offline&amp;quot; part refers to the location of the saves (client-side) and the inability to play with other players. In order to play Offline mode, one still needs to connect to the Battle.net servers every 30 days.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
===Online===&lt;br /&gt;
* This is the &amp;quot;Closed Battle.net&amp;quot; experience.&lt;br /&gt;
* Saves are stored server-side.&lt;br /&gt;
* The other multiplayer game modes, such as Open Battle.net, TCP/IP or modded realms are not available in D2R.&lt;br /&gt;
: This change made it impossible to use hacked characters in multiplayer, but at the same time killed multiplayer mods.&lt;br /&gt;
* D2R servers are completely separate from original Battle.net, and one cannot play on them with the legacy Diablo II or vice versa.&lt;br /&gt;
* There are 3 regions available: Americas, Europe and Asia, but unlike in the predecessor, in D2R online saves are global. Players can freely switch regions for better latency, without losing progress. [https://us.forums.blizzard.com/en/d2r/t/how-does-servers-work-for-d2r/14234/3]&lt;br /&gt;
* There is no cross-play (players on different platforms cannot play together), although there is cross-progression (if one owns D2R on multiple platforms, online saves are synced between them).&lt;br /&gt;
: Trading between platforms is possible for players who own D2R on multiple platforms (by cross-progression save syncing), or they can mediate trades between those who do not.&lt;br /&gt;

==Quality of Life==&lt;br /&gt;
* Gold can be picked up by simply moving over it.&lt;br /&gt;
* The Windows version can be played via game controller instead of mouse and keyboard.&lt;br /&gt;
* Using game controller skill selection is much easier than via mouse and keyboard.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
==Item==&lt;br /&gt;
* The Stash in the Expansion mode now contains 4 tabs: the first tab is the individual 10×10 stash of each character, like in the original game&amp;#039;s Expansion mode; the three other 10×10 tabs are shared between all Expansion characters on an account (although separately for SC/HC and NLD/LD).&lt;br /&gt;
** After a ladder reset, the shared stash is emptied and its content moved to a withdraw-only stash non-ladder characters.&lt;br /&gt;
** Classic characters are limited to the original 4×6 individual stash, and no shared stash. &lt;br /&gt;
* Items and [[Rune Word]]s that were ladder-only in LoD are available in single player and non-ladder games.&lt;br /&gt;
* Some old RWs can be made in additional bases. [https://news.blizzard.com/en-us/diablo2/23788293/diablo-ii-resurrected-patch-2-4-ladder-now-live#rune]&lt;br /&gt;
* New [[Rune Word]]s; initially ladder-only; later some were made non-ladder [https://news.blizzard.com/en-us/diablo2/23788293/diablo-ii-resurrected-patch-2-4-ladder-now-live#rune] [https://news.blizzard.com/en-us/article/23899624/diablo-ii-resurrected-ladder-season-three-has-concluded#Rune]&lt;br /&gt;
* Buffed underused {{S|=set items}} [https://news.blizzard.com/en-us/diablo2/23788293/diablo-ii-resurrected-patch-2-4-ladder-now-live#set] and new [[Horadric Cube|cube recipes]] to upgrade the tier of set items. [https://news.blizzard.com/en-us/diablo2/23788293/diablo-ii-resurrected-patch-2-4-ladder-now-live#horadric]&lt;br /&gt;
* [[Sunder]] mechanics added - [[immune|immune monsters]] are no longer a hard counter for most builds. [https://news.blizzard.com/en-us/article/23827590/diablo-ii-resurrected-ladder-season-two-has-concluded#Charms]&lt;br /&gt;
* New [[unique charm]]s. [https://news.blizzard.com/en-us/diablo2/23827590/diablo-ii-resurrected-ladder-season-two-has-concluded#Charms]&lt;br /&gt;

==[[Hireling]]==&lt;br /&gt;
* Stats do not depend on the difficulty level they were hired on.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
===[[Rogue Scout]]===&lt;br /&gt;
* Can use [[Amazon bow]]s and benefits from [[Amazon Skill Levels]].&lt;br /&gt;
====Fire====&lt;br /&gt;
* Added [[Exploding Arrow]]&lt;br /&gt;
====Cold====&lt;br /&gt;
* Added [[Freezing Arrow]]&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
===[[Desert Mercenary]]===&lt;br /&gt;
* On [[Nightmare]] and [[Hell]] all 6 different aura types are available.&lt;br /&gt;
:* No longer called &amp;quot;Combat&amp;quot;/&amp;quot;Offensive&amp;quot;/&amp;quot;Defensive&amp;quot;.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
===[[Iron Wolf]]===&lt;br /&gt;
* Increased [[life]], [[defense]] and [[resistance]]s. Now has the highest resistances compared to other hirelings.&lt;br /&gt;
====Cold====&lt;br /&gt;
* Uses [[Chilling Armor]] instead of [[Frozen Armor]].&lt;br /&gt;
====Fire====&lt;br /&gt;
* Uses [[Fire Bolt]] instead of [[Inferno]].&lt;br /&gt;
* Added [[Enchant]].&lt;br /&gt;
====Lightning====&lt;br /&gt;
* Added [[Static Field]].&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
===[[Barbarian (mercenary)|Barbarian]]===&lt;br /&gt;
* Benefits from [[Barbarian Skill Levels]].&lt;br /&gt;
* Increased [[life]] and [[defense]]. Now has the highest life and defense compared to other hirelings.&lt;br /&gt;
====Two-handed====&lt;br /&gt;
* Added [[Battle Cry]].&lt;br /&gt;
====Dual Wielding====&lt;br /&gt;
* New hireling type.&lt;br /&gt;
* Skills: [[Frenzy]], [[Taunt]], [[Iron Skin]]&lt;br /&gt;
* Weapon: two one-handed swords.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
==[[Quest]]==&lt;br /&gt;
* The [[World Event]] is available in single player, and requires the player to sell one [[The Stone of Jordan|Stone of Jordan]] [[unique ring]].&lt;br /&gt;
: On multiplayer World Event, once triggered, occurs in all the games on a whole region, not on a specific IP.&lt;br /&gt;
* The [[Pandemonium Event]] is available in single player.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
==[[Area]]==&lt;br /&gt;
* Contrary to Classic and the Expansion, killing the [[Cow King]] does not remove the ability to create the portal to the [[Moo Moo Farm]].&lt;br /&gt;
* Buffed some area levels to level 85 [https://news.blizzard.com/en-us/diablo2/23788293/diablo-ii-resurrected-patch-2-4-ladder-now-live#level]&lt;br /&gt;
* [[Terror Zone]]s were introduced.&lt;/div&gt;</summary>
